An exciting opportunity to develop your teaching, clinical and leadership skills whilst supporting pharmacists from the very start of their initial education and training journey.
Working in an acute hospital, as clinical lecturer with the University of Brighton, you will deliver both experiential and academic learning to pharmacy undergraduates, including the progressive inclusion of prescribing practice during foundation training by 2025. Additionally, you will make key contributions to the delivery of our strategic vision for education and development within the pharmacy department, gaining experience across several different dimensions through inter‑professional education within the trust and working closely with multi‑sector partner organisations within the Integrated Care System to develop the future pharmacist workforce.
There will be opportunities for personal and professional development including the Independent Prescribing Course.
